About Harrogate Test Centre
Harrogate driving test centre is located at Skipton Road, Harrogate, North Yorkshire, HG1 3HH in North Yorkshire, Yorkshire and the Humber. With a pass rate of 50.7%, it ranks #122 out of 250 DVSA test centres nationally.
Harrogate has a pass rate close to the national average of 50.6%. The test routes here include a typical mix of residential roads, main roads, and junctions that provide a balanced assessment of driving ability.

How Harrogate Compares
Compared to the Yorkshire and the Humber regional average of 47.4%, Harrogate is above average. The national average sits at 50.6%.
